I don't used that Optical Read, but you are right it does not start if you delete
all Files in the List.

I checked it and now it works fine, here you go mate!

SamsungOCR3.apk needs the following to start:
Folder Root/System: opticalreader (with all it´s contents)

Folder Root/system/lib:
libBarcodeDecoderPacked.so
libDioDict3EngineNativeService.so
libDioDict4EngineNativeService.so
libDioOcrEngine.so[/B]

I will edit my List therefore! ;)
